Given Orleans' climate, with wet winters and dry summers, considering covered or indoor boat parking is wise to shield your boat from rain, sun, and potential debris. Many local options cater to seasonal needs, offering dry storage during off-peak months and convenient launch access when you're ready to hit the river. Look for facilities along Highway 96 or near the Orleans area that provide security features like gated access and surveillance, as remote locations can benefit from added protection. Don't hesitate to ask neighbors or local marinas—such as those in nearby Weitchpec or Somes Bar—for recommendations, as word-of-mouth often reveals hidden gems in this tight-knit community.
When evaluating boat parking near you, factor in the Klamath River's conditions, including water levels and seasonal closures for salmon runs. Some storage spots offer riverfront access, making launch days a breeze, but ensure they're on stable ground to avoid flood risks during winter rains. For smaller boats, like those used for fishing, consider compact storage solutions that might be available on private land or through local outfitters. Always check local regulations, as Humboldt County may have specific rules for outdoor storage, especially in environmentally sensitive areas.
